Ghana: 8-year-old drowns in River Adjei

An 8-year old boy has drown in River Adjei at Nurses Quarters near Domeabra in the Ga South Municipality of the Greater Accra Region, Ghana.

According to reports, the boy went missing for a day.

“The deceased went to the river together with his 12-year-old elder brother and friends to swim but did not return home,” Adom News said.

The relative said they received a distress call of a body floating in the river the next day.

His body was, however, retrieved with the help of some residents.

The deceased’s family spokesperson, said the absence of bridge on the river is threatening their lives.
